Another alternate Creation! Yay! But this time, the Lunars rule instead of the Dragon-blooded, and you are Lunars on the side of the returning Solars. For this game, I will take no fewer than three Lunars, and possibly a single Solar, Sidereal and Terrestrial, up to a total of six players.

There are a few house rules due to the nature of the setting as well as my personal preferences.

- Everyone gets 25 xp to start with.
- The original five Lunar Castes from the First Age still exist, and there are no moonsilver tattoos. Which also means there are no tattoo artifacts, no Wyld limit, no chimeras and no immunity to physical shaping effects.
- All Lunars have one extra dot of artifact made of moonsilver, free of charge (so if you have three dots in artifact, you can have a 4-dot artifact, as long as it is made out of moonsilver, or a three-dot non-moonsilver artifact and a one-dot moonsilver artifact).
- Lunar Exalted use these (http://wiki.white-wolf.com/exalted/index.php?title=Peter_Schaefer_on_Lunar_Character_ Generation) character generation rules.
- All PC Lunars have 4 dots of Solar Bond, free of charge, and can raise it to 5 for the cost of one background dot or bonus point.
- Essence 3 (and only Essence 3) costs 5 points for Solars (and Abyssals and Infernals, if they are allowed) and 7 points for other Exalted.
- All Dragon-blooded get EITHER one free dot in War and one dot in Archery, Martial Arts, Melee or Thrown OR one free dot in Socialize and one dot in Investigation, Performance or Presence.
- Solars (and Abyssals) get 5 free Excellencies chosen from their Caste and Favored Abilities, Sidereals and Dragon-blooded get 4 free Excellencies chosen from their Aspect, Auspicious and Favored Abilities, and Lunars get 2 free Excellencies chosen from their Caste and Favored Attributes. You can only have one free Excellency per Ability or Attribute. (Infernals, if they are allowed, will have all current and future purchases of First [their Caste's patron Yozi] Excellency for free.)
- New fields of Craft can be opened by paying the cost of a one-dot Craft specialty. Anyone who buys dots in Craft starts with one free field.
- There are only 9 fields of Craft: Air, Earth, Fire, Water, Wood, Glamour, Magitech, Vitriol and Genesis. Any other Craft ability either uses another Craft, the lower of Craft and another ability, or Lore.
- Sorcery and necromancy initiation Charms grant one spell of the appropriate circle for free.
- Flaws are allowed on a provisional and case-by-case basis.
- Artifact reinforced breastplate costs 2 dots, while artifact articulated plate and superheavy plate cost 3 dots.
- Homebrew Charms are allowed on a case-by-case basis as long as you provide me the source and ask for my approval.
